Trying to rank higher on AI-powered search engines? We’ve got some bad news. According to Profound, an AI-marketing platform, referral traffic from ChatGPT is down 52%. Josh Blyskal, an employee at Profound, attributed the low results to ChatGPT’s recent strategy of “shifting towards sites that provide answers,” which has reduced long tail citations. The report comes just one month after a Similarweb study reported that “ChatGPT referrals to news sites jumped from under 1 million visits during January through May 2024 to more than 25 million in the corresponding 2025 period. ”
Meanwhile, sites like Wikipedia, Reddit, and TechRadar have seen rapid citation growth. “The top 3 domains (Wikipedia, Reddit, TechRadar) combined have grown +53%, now controlling 22% of all citations,” Blyskal recently said. “That’s 1 in 5 ChatGPT citations going to just three sites.”
Why Does This Matter?
- ChatGPT’s new strategy affects your website’s ability to rank better on its search engine. If the platform is preferring to cite “answer-first” sources (Reddit and Quora), your website could potentially lose out on gaining new traffic.
- It also kills “call-to-actions.” “When someone asks ‘what’s the best CRM for startups?'” Blyskal wrote, “and a brand page says ‘Schedule a demo’ while Reddit has a thread comparing 10 options, Reddit gets cited.”
How Can You Try to Increase Your Referral Traffic on ChatGPT?
Trying to get ranked on ChatGPT is much different from trying to get ranked on Google. You’ll need to re-optimize your website’s content, from altering its structure to rethinking your schema markup. Here’s how:
- Make your content more direct. Get rid of the fluff, and give what the people are looking for: answers.
- Include comparison tables. AI-powered search engines typically include comparison pages, as it registers these additions as an “authoritative voice.”
- Use more citations and statistics to back up your content. As we wrote in our recent blog on GEO (which stands for Generative Engine Optimization), “When websites utilized these tools, they experienced a 40% increase in visibility.”
